Episode 2906 was broadcast on 18 December 2000, and was the second quarter-final of Series 43.

Graham Nash played Gordon Cusworth, with Graham Nash winning 60 – 50. The Dictionary Corner guest was Anya Sitaram, and the lexicographer was Richard Samson.
